I. Three Hundred Foxes (15:1-8)

1. What did Samson decide to do? (1) What bad news did his father-in-law tell him? (2) Why might Samson's father-in-law do this?

2. How does Samson's statement tell us what he really intended? (3) What did he do to inflict heavy damage on Israel's oppressors? (4-5) Was Samson's actions just in the eyes of the Lord? (Heb. 11:32-40)

3. What form of justice did the Philistines enact? (6) How did Samson use it to his cause? (7) Why did he need to stay in a cave? (8)

II. I Have Made Donkey's of Them (15:9-17)

4. Why did the Philistines need to muster an army to capture Samson? (9) How did the Jews respond? (10)

5. Did his fellow Israelites appreciate what he was doing for them? (11) What must have he felt like when they told him their intent? (12) How did their betrayal foreshadow what happened to Jesus? (13; Acts 3:12-15)

6. How did the Lord bless Samson's faith? (14) What miracle took place? (15-16) How does his life of faith agree and differ from ours?

III. Samson's Thirst (15:18-20)

7. What can be learned about Samson's relationship with the Lord through verse 18? What kind of relationship do believer's in Jesus now have? (Eph. 1:3-10) How does our relationship with him grow? (John 6:53-57)

8. How did the Lord answer his prayer? (19) What can be learned?

9. How can the Bible claim Samson lead Israel when they betrayed him to their enemies? (20)
